About Ranking Joe :

Born Joseph Jackson in Kingston on 1st June 1959, Joe got his start on record with the founding father of Jamaican music, producer Coxsone Dodd (Studio 1), cutting "Gun Court" in 1975 as Little Joe. He then recorded for a variety of producers including Bunny Lee, Watty Burnett and former African Brother Derrick Howard. By 1976 he was deejaying on the legendary sound system of Daddy U-Roy, Stur-Gav Hi-Fi, and recording for producer Prince Tony Robinson. His first album for that producer was released in 1977 and included hits like "John Saw Them Coming" and "Queen Majesty Chapter 3". He continued to deejay with U-Roy's set,
building up a formidable reputation as a live deejay. He began recording hits for Sonia Pottinger ("Shine Eye Gal" 1978) and was the first deejay to record for Sly & Robbie's Taxi label when he versioned Gregory Isaacs' hit "Soon Forward" ("Stop Your Coming & Come" in 1978).
